@ -0,0 +1,90 @@
using System;
using Gdk;
using GLib;
using Gtk;
namespace DMX2
{
public class ContextMenuEventArgs : EventArgs
{
private Widget widget;
public Widget Widget { get { return widget; } }
private bool rightClick;
public bool RightClick { get { return rightClick; } }
public ContextMenuEventArgs (Widget widget, bool rightClick)
{
this.widget = widget;
this.rightClick = rightClick;
}
}
public class ContextMenuHelper
{
public event EventHandler<ContextMenuEventArgs> ContextMenu;
public ContextMenuHelper ()
{
}
public ContextMenuHelper (Widget widget)
{
AttachToWidget (widget);
}
public ContextMenuHelper (Widget widget, EventHandler<ContextMenuEventArgs> handler)
{
AttachToWidget (widget);
ContextMenu += handler;
}
public void AttachToWidget (Widget widget)
{
widget.PopupMenu += Widget_PopupMenu;
widget.ButtonPressEvent += Widget_ButtonPressEvent;
}
public void DetachFromWidget (Widget widget)
{
widget.PopupMenu -= Widget_PopupMenu;
widget.ButtonPressEvent -= Widget_ButtonPressEvent;
}
[GLib.ConnectBefore]
private void Widget_PopupMenu (object o, PopupMenuArgs args)
{
RaiseContextMenuEvent (args, (Widget)o, false);
}
[GLib.ConnectBefore]
private void Widget_ButtonPressEvent (object o, ButtonPressEventArgs args)
{
if (args.Event.Button == 3 && args.Event.Type == EventType.ButtonPress) {
RaiseContextMenuEvent (args, (Widget)o, true);
}
}
private bool propagating = false; //Prevent reentry
private void RaiseContextMenuEvent (SignalArgs signalArgs, Widget widget, bool rightClick)
{
if (!propagating) {
//Propagate the event
Event evnt = Gtk.Global.CurrentEvent;
propagating = true;
Gtk.Global.PropagateEvent (widget, evnt);
propagating = false;
signalArgs.RetVal = true; //The widget already processed the event in the propagation
//Raise the context menu event
ContextMenuEventArgs args = new ContextMenuEventArgs (widget, rightClick);
if (ContextMenu != null) {
ContextMenu.Invoke (this, args);
}
}
}
}
}
